The Role
With our growing focus on data-driven HR strategies, we are seeking a forward-thinking People Analytics Manager (m/f/d) to join our HR team. You will play a key role in expanding our HR analytics landscape, developing meaningful metrics, and providing insights that drive business success and employee engagement.
Key Responsibilities
- Supporting the identification and development of new (HR) KPIs.
- Using Tableau to create dashboards and reports, ensuring data accuracy and clarity.
- Evaluating and analyzing historical and predictive HR-related metrics and data, and deriving actionable measures.
- Conducting ad-hoc analyses and assisting in regular reporting and analysis.
- Identifying trends, risks, and opportunities within the HR data landscape and recommending improvements to processes and reporting methodologies.
- Collaborating closely with colleagues in HR, Controlling, IT, and Payroll to ensure integrated and effective data solutions.
Key Requirements
- 3+ years of experience in People Analytics and/or HR Controlling.
- Completed degree in a relevant field such as Economics, Business Analytics, or a related discipline.
- Strong proficiency in both German and English.
- Affinity for numbers, systems, and processes, coupled with excellent analytical skills.
- Highly perceptive and able to translate data into actionable insights.
- Ideally, initial experience with Tableau and/or SAP SuccessFactors.
- Strong communication and presentation skills to effectively share findings and recommendations.
